India, July 21 -- Electric two-wheeler maker Ather Energy has raised about Rs.1,300 Cr through a qualified institutional placement (QIP), allotting 1.08 Cr equity shares to investors at an issue price of Rs.1,202 per share.

The issue price was about 2.8% higher than the Rs.1,169.70 apiece floor price set by the company.

The QIP opened on July 15 and closed yesterday, the company said in an exchange filing.

Among the largest allottees were HDFC Mutual Fund, Aditya Birla Sun Life Mutual Fund, Axis Mutual Fund, Edelweiss Mutual Fund, Tata Mutual Fund, Motilal Oswal Mutual Fund, and Abu Dhabi Investment Authority, each receiving more than 5% of the total issue size.
